The opportunity
We are looking for a Senior Manager within the Internal Audit team in our Sydney office. This role is offered on a flexible full time basis.
Your key responsibilities
- Work with high-growth clients and other market leaders in all Sectors
- Establish objectives and scope of work; establish the engagement budget; and take responsibility for the overall execution of the project through wrap-up and final report delivery, in compliance with EY quality requirements
- Lead internal audit engagements and risk assessments
- Maintain a strong client focus by effectively serving client needs and developing productive working relationships with client personnel
- Work with team members to set goals and responsibilities for specific engagements.
- Utilise technology and tools to continually learn and innovate, share knowledge with team members and enhance service delivery
- Strong analytical, interpersonal and communication skills
- Demonstrated consistency in values, principles, and work ethic
- Strong skills in project management and engagement management
- Strong skills in leading a team of diverse employees
- A bachelor's degree in accounting, finance or a business-related field
- A minimum of 8 years of related business experience in internal control and internal audit experience
- Experience in internal audit and good knowledge of IIA Standards required
- Experience in enterprise risk management (ERM), data analytics and continuous control monitoring (CCM) and GRC considered an asset
- CIA or CPA certification required
